Searched refs:ioctl_mtx (Results 1 - 2 of 2) sorted by relevance

/freebsd-10-stable/sys/cam/ctl/
H A Dctl_frontend_ioctl.c67 struct mtx ioctl_mtx; member in struct:ctl_fe_ioctl_params
290 mtx_lock(&params->ioctl_mtx);
293 mtx_unlock(&params->ioctl_mtx);
304 mtx_lock(&params->ioctl_mtx);
307 mtx_unlock(&params->ioctl_mtx);
318 mtx_init(&params.ioctl_mtx, "ctliocmtx", NULL, MTX_DEF);
334 mtx_lock(&params.ioctl_mtx);
342 cv_wait(&params.sem, &params.ioctl_mtx);
350 mtx_unlock(&params.ioctl_mtx);
361 mtx_unlock(&params.ioctl_mtx);
[all...]
/freebsd-10-stable/sys/dev/mmc/
H A Dmmcsd.c106 struct mtx ioctl_mtx; member in struct:mmcsd_part
214 #define MMCSD_IOCTL_LOCK(_part) mtx_lock(&(_part)->ioctl_mtx)
215 #define MMCSD_IOCTL_UNLOCK(_part) mtx_unlock(&(_part)->ioctl_mtx)
217 mtx_init(&(_part)->ioctl_mtx, (_part)->name, "mmcsd IOCTL", MTX_DEF)
218 #define MMCSD_IOCTL_LOCK_DESTROY(_part) mtx_destroy(&(_part)->ioctl_mtx);
220 mtx_assert(&(_part)->ioctl_mtx, MA_OWNED);
222 mtx_assert(&(_part)->ioctl_mtx, MA_NOTOWNED);
680 msleep(part, &part->ioctl_mtx, 0,
746 msleep(part, &part->ioctl_mtx, 0,
914 msleep(part, &part->ioctl_mtx,
[all...]

Completed in 75 milliseconds